Dead Inside by Barry J. Hutchison

5.0

Dan returns in the second book in the Dan Deadman Series. This time we delve deeper into the detective trope and explore more of the massive city, Down There. I appreciated that the seemingly innocuous events set up throughout the book all had satisfying payoffs in the end. This book was cleverly written, with a well thought out plot, and fleshed out characters. Artur and Ollie are back too, with the former carrying more of the comedic load this time. Not to be outdone, Ollie flexes her skills this time around with terrifying results. Overall I very much enjoyed Dead Inside, and recommend it to anyone who is a fan of Dial D for Deadman.
